Abstract
The Forth-and-Back Implicit Lambda Iteration (FBILI) is efficient Gauss-Seidel-type iterative scheme developed by Atanackovic-Vukmanovic et al. [1] for a solution of non-LTE radiative transfer (RT) problems of spectral line formation in stellar atmospheres. In [2] it was more explicitly implemented on non-linear line transfer in multi-level atomic models in 1D geometry, providing high convergence rate to the exact solution with no use of additional acceleration techniques. Here, we apply FBILI on a standard benchmark problem of CaII line formation in the solar atmosphere using the VALCH atmospheric model. Additionally we compare its accuracy with the well known code MULTI.
